Greetings fellow musicians and fans of Domenico Scarlatti. This piece is one of seven Scarlatti sonatas for harpsichord arranged by Dan Reiter for a trio of flute, harp, and cello.

Sonata K208 is one of the best-loved Scarlatti sonatas. It opens with a tender and elegant theme that sets the tone for the entire piece. It includes delicate, ornamented passages that require finesse and sensitivity from the performers and features a blend of lyrical melodies and intricate decorations, creating a rich and nuanced musical tapestry. The harp repeats are not written out to allow the harpist to improvise variations on the repeats.
